Subject: Key rotation for InvoiceForge renderer

Welcome, new folks. Every quarter we rotate the credential the Pellworth PDF invoice renderer uses to call our internal asset service, Vaultline. The old key stops working Friday at noon. Update your local .env and the staging config before then, and verify a test invoice renders with the new embedded fonts. For convenience, the freshly issued key is included here.

app token of bagef-bageg = kto11_vuwA0uhrEMg

## Changelog — Bramblewiki 3.8.0

**Changed defaults: role-based access**

New spaces now default to `viewer` for authenticated users instead of `editor`. Anonymous access is disabled by default; admins must opt in per space. Existing spaces are untouched, but the migration script logs any space still using legacy group mappings. Reviewers should check that permission checks read from the new `roles` table, not the deprecated ACL cache. The shipped defaults are below.

settings of bafof-fajog:
[aldix]
port = 9300
region = north-3
host = aldix.kelvilabs.example
team = istath
timeout_ms = 1500
retries = 8

Ticket #— Floor 9 Opening Prep, Brindlemoor House

Hi facilities folks, Floor 9 opens to staff next Monday and we need a few things squared away before then. Lift access is live, but the two side doors by the kitchenette are still on the old lock config — please reprogram them before Friday. Also, signage for the quiet rooms hasn't arrived, so pop up the temporary printed ones for now. Until the badge readers sync, the interim door code for Floor 9 is below.

door code, bajop-bajog: bdg-DSWAC-43621

## BUG-4471: Per-item rounding inflates converted totals

Affects plugin authors using the Coinlathe conversion hook. Steps to reproduce: (1) create an invoice with 17 line items at 0.335 units each, (2) convert from marks to crowns via the plugin API, (3) compare the summed converted lines against the converted total. Expected: difference under 0.005. Actual: drift of 0.04 because rounding happens per line. Repro scripts must authenticate against the sandbox; use the token below.

portal login ticket: eyJhbGciOiJIUzI1NiIsInR5cCI6IkpXVCJ9.eyJzdWIiOiIwEOsktwVNwIn0.-UJU3fdyyCgG